Understanding the Rights of the Accused
Individuals who are accused of a crime have certain rights granted by the U.S. Constitution that must be upheld throughout the criminal justice process. These rights serve as the foundation for a fair and equitable criminal justice system, ensuring the protection of the rights of the accused and maintaining public confidence in the legal framework.
The Right to Remain Silent
The right to remain silent is a fundamental constitutional protection that allows the accused to avoid self-incrimination. This right applies during arrest, interrogation, and all stages of the criminal justice process. Exercising this right can prevent the prosecution from using statements made by the defendant against them in court.
The Right to a Speedy Trial
The right to a speedy trial ensures that the accused is not subjected to indefinite detention without a prompt determination of their criminal charges. This constitutional guarantee helps safeguard the rights of the accused and prevents the erosion of evidence or the memories of witnesses over time.
The Right to Legal Counsel
The right to legal counsel is a crucial constitutional right that allows the accused to be represented by an attorney throughout the criminal justice process. A skilled criminal defense attorney can help protect the rights of the accused, develop an effective defense strategy, and ensure a fair trial.
Protection from Unreasonable Search and Seizure
The Fourth Amendment of the U.S. Constitution provides protection from unreasonable search and seizure, safeguarding the accused from unlawful intrusions by law enforcement. This right is particularly relevant in DUI defense cases, where the legality of traffic stops and evidence collection can be thoroughly examined.

Essential Aspects of Criminal Trials
In criminal trials, understanding the essential aspects of the legal process is crucial for mounting an effective defense. First and foremost, the charges against the defendant must be thoroughly reviewed to identify weaknesses in the prosecution’s evidence and develop a strategic defensive approach.
Reviewing the Charges
By closely examining the criminal charges, the defense attorney can focus on cross-examining witnesses and challenging the admissibility of evidence presented by the prosecution. This meticulous review aims to create reasonable doubt in the minds of the jury, ultimately leading to a favorable outcome for the client.
Strategic Jury Selection
The selection of an impartial and unbiased jury has become increasingly important in criminal trials. Defense attorneys must carefully analyze the demographics and potential biases of each prospective juror to ensure that the final panel is receptive to the defendant’s narrative and defense strategy.
Plea Bargaining
In some cases, plea bargaining can offer a viable alternative to a full-fledged criminal trial. Through pre-trial negotiations between the defense attorney and the prosecutor, the defendant may be able to secure reduced charges or other mutually beneficial agreements, avoiding the risks and uncertainties of going to trial.
Common Defense Strategies
Criminal defense attorneys employ a variety of legal strategies to challenge the prosecution’s case and obtain the best possible outcome for their clients. These strategies include challenging the admissibility or credibility of evidence presented by the prosecution, providing a credible alibi, arguing self-defense, and leveraging expert witness testimony.
Challenging Evidence
One of the core criminal defense strategies is challenging the evidence presented by the prosecution. This may involve questioning witness statements, challenging forensic evidence, or seeking to exclude illegally obtained evidence. By meticulously examining the prosecution’s case, defense attorneys can create reasonable doubt and undermine the strength of the charges.
Presenting an Alibi
Providing a credible alibi for the time of the alleged crime can be a powerful strategy for obtaining a not-guilty verdict. By demonstrating that the defendant was in a different location at the time of the incident, the defense can effectively rebut the prosecution’s claims and establish the client’s innocence.
Arguing Self-Defense
In cases where the defendant claims self-defense, the attorney must construct a compelling argument that aligns with local self-defense laws. This may involve presenting evidence of the defendant’s reasonable fear of imminent harm, as well as the proportionality of their response to the perceived threat.
Expert Witness Testimony
The use of expert witness testimony can be crucial in more complex criminal cases. Experts in fields such as forensics, psychology, or scientific analysis can provide valuable insights and technical evidence to support the defense’s case. By leveraging expert witness testimony, defense attorneys can strengthen their arguments and challenge the prosecution’s claims.
Understanding Legal Processes
Navigating the criminal justice system can be overwhelming, especially when unfamiliar with how it works. Understanding the legal processes involved is crucial for individuals accused of crimes who want to protect their rights and achieve a fair outcome.
Arrest and Booking
The process begins with an arrest by law enforcement officials who suspect the individual of committing a crime, followed by the booking stage where identifying details are recorded.
Arraignment and Discovery
After being charged, defendants appear before a judge for arraignment, where they’re informed of their charges, rights, and bond. During the discovery process, the prosecution may provide copies of their evidence and witness statements to the defense.
Pre-trial Motions
Pre-trial motions are requests made by defense counsel for the court’s consideration before trial, such as motions to suppress evidence or dismiss the case due to lack of probable cause.
Trial Proceedings
Finally, if the defendant proceeds to trial, a jury will evaluate the evidence presented by both sides and decide on guilt beyond a reasonable doubt, with the judge then imposing a sentence based on guidelines.

DUI Defense
Defending against a DUI charge requires an in-depth understanding of the complex laws and procedures surrounding these cases. A skilled criminal defense attorney specializing in DUI defense can challenge the prosecution’s evidence, such as field sobriety tests or breathalyzer results, and work to mitigate the potential penalties. They may also explore alternative sentencing options, such as alcohol education programs, to help clients avoid the most severe consequences of a DUI conviction.
Drug Offense Defense
Drug-related charges, whether for possession, distribution, or manufacturing, can have long-lasting impacts on an individual’s life. A criminal defense attorney who specializes in drug offense cases can help navigate the legal system, protect your rights, and explore options for reduced charges or alternative sentencing. They may also be able to challenge the legality of search and seizure procedures or the admissibility of evidence used against you.
Violent Crime Defense
Charges for violent crimes, such as assault, battery, or homicide, require a meticulous legal defense strategy. An experienced criminal defense attorney who specializes in these types of cases can thoroughly investigate the circumstances, challenge the prosecution’s evidence, and present a compelling case on your behalf. They may also explore opportunities for plea bargaining or sentencing mitigation to help minimize the potential consequences.
